Conformational Stereoisomerism in Cyclohexane

Three distinct conformational stereoisomers (conformers) can be recognized for cyclohexane: the chair, the boat, and thw twist boat. The boat is actually a metastable structure, representing the highest energy conformation on the path between the chair and the boat.
